Day four, Jarama Sami camp, Sweden: I can't help thinking minimalist white interiors are a little bit 90s. And it's not often you wake up and realise you are inhaling ice. But we survived the night.
"It was actually quite cosy," claims Jenny Willott as she emerges to the disbelief of her companions. Nick Clegg says he hasn't slept a wink (though others in his igloo claimed to have heard him snoring) and Emily Thornberry has a simple take: "Done sleeping in an igloo. Don't need to do it again."
It isn't the ideal start to a day's sledding, especially since temperatures have tumbled again overnight and many of the dogs are in a querulous mood.
